		<description>Francofilter (part 1): I would like to start listening to French music. Can you recommend places online to find good, (legally) free music with French singing? &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; I&apos;m about to be nominated to a Peace Corps program in Francophone sub-Saharan Africa. I&apos;ll probably have questions about language training (I have no French background) and other things about the region before my departure (hopefully in early May), hence the &quot;part 1.&quot; In the meantime, though, I&apos;m going through the recordings and books offered &lt;a href=&quot;http://fsi-language-courses.com/&quot;&gt;here&lt;/a&gt; from the U.S. State Department&apos;s Foreign Service Institute, and I&apos;m starting to study the region...so part 1 is music!&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
I have a pretty long commute, so I thought it might be cool  to listen to French singing that I might somewhat passively absorb - for instance, I can tolerably well sing along with Rufus Wainwright&apos;s &quot;La Complainte de la Butte&quot; from Moulin Rouge...er, well at least I think I can. Never mind that. The point is that it won&apos;t hurt my brain like audio lessons will, which is bad when one is driving, but it&apos;s still helping me get used to the sounds of the language.&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
My main constraints are that it be free, and that the singer would be easily understood by a French speaker, without it being a kid&apos;s song. Bonus points for music that would actually be heard in sub-Saharan Africa, but that&apos;s not really the focus. My musical tastes are fairly broad and I don&apos;t want to limit answers too much in that dimension.&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
To reiterate an important point, I don&apos;t want to download illegal stuff. I&apos;m looking for recordings that are public domain, or that the artist has intentionally made available for free.</description>

		<description>I love &lt;a href=&quot;http://blogue.bandeapart.fm/&quot;&gt;bandeapart.fm&lt;/a&gt;. I initially ran into their podcast via iTunes where you can also download it. They are from Quebec and play really cool Canadian French-language music. A fairly indie-rock focus with some hip-hop and some unclassifiable. My favorite part is when they talk between songs. I learned French from a Parisian teacher and have been to France a few times, but I was pretty unfamiliar with the Quebecois accent. It is awesome. It&apos;s full on Candian, but yet speaking French. Actually much easier to understand for me than your average Parisian. But also on this blog, great music! I found out about the band &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.myspace.com/malajube&quot;&gt;Malajube&lt;/a&gt;, for instance, from their podcast.</description>

		<description>Do an iTunes search for &quot;Radio Canada,&quot; and browse through the podcasts. It&apos;s the French-language national radio station. A lot of it is spoken, but there&apos;s a few &quot;here&apos;s the hits!&quot; podcasts. (it you see &apos;chanson&apos; or &apos;palmares,&apos; it&apos;s a mostly-song-based show.) &l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
Of course, the French doesn&apos;t sound too too much like the French you&apos;d find in Africa, but it&apos;s still French.</description>
